Important Commands 25% Log into local & remote visual and text mode consoles Look for files Evaluate and compare the fundamental file system functions and options Compare and control file material Use input-output redirection (e. g (Linux Foundation Certified System Administrator). >, >>,, 2 >) Examine a text using standard regular expressions Archive, backup, compress, unload, and uncompress files Create, erase, copy, and move files and directories Produce and handle tough and soft links List, set, and change basic file authorizations Check out, and use system documents Manage access to the root account Operation of Running Systems 20% Boot, reboot, and closed down a system securely Boot or change system into various operating modes Install, configure and troubleshoot bootloaders Detect and handle processes Find and examine system log files Arrange tasks to perform at a set date and time Validate completion of set up jobs Update software application to provide required functionality and security Confirm the integrity and accessibility of resources Validate the integrity and accessibility of key processes Change kernel runtime criteria, relentless and non-persistent Use scripting to automate system maintenance jobs Manage the startup procedure and services (In Providers Configuration) List and recognize SELinux/App, Armor file and procedure contexts Manage Software application Identify the element of a Linux distribution that a file belongs to Amazon link (affiliate) User and Group Management 10% Create, erase, and modify local user accounts Develop, erase, and modify local groups and group subscriptions Handle system-wide environment profiles Handle template user environment Configure user resource limits Manage user opportunities Configure PAM Networking 12% Configure networking and hostname resolution statically or dynamically Configure network services to start immediately at boot Implement package filtering Start, stop and examine the status of network services Statically path IP traffic Synchronize time using other network peers Service Setup 20% Set up a caching DNS server Preserve a DNS zone Configure email aliases Configure SSH servers and clients Restrict access to the HTTP proxy server Set up an IMAP and IMAPS service Question and modify the behavior of system services at numerous operating modes Set up an HTTP server Configure HTTP server log files Configure a database server Limit access to a websites Manage and configure containers Manage and set up Virtual Makers Storage Management 13% List, create, erase, and modify physical storage partitions Handle and set up LVM storage Create and configure encrypted storage Configure systems to install file systems at or throughout boot Configure and manage swap area Develop and handle RAID gadgets Configure systems to mount file systems as needed Develop, manage and detect sophisticated file system approvals Set up user and group disk quotas for filesystems Develop and set up file systems.
